Dartford 0 Forest Green Rovers 1

Dartford dropped out of the Blue Square Bet Premier play-off spots on Tuesday night after losing at home to Forest Green Rovers for the second time in a fortnight.

The Gloucestershire side knocked Dartford out of the FA Cup last month and they went ahead when Yan Klukowski fired a shot into the top corner after 11 minutes.

Things got worse for the Darts when striker Harry Crawford, pictured, was sent off for retaliation. Minutes later it was 10-a-side when Forest Green had Jamie Turley dismissed for tangling with Lee Noble off the ball.

Noble saw one effort flash wide and another hit the woodwork but Dartford finished scoreless at Princes Park for the first time this season as the visitors leap-frogged them into fifth.

Dartford visit third-placed Luton Town on Saturday.
